Certificate in Vaccine Hesitancy & Minority Communities
-- viewing nowThe Certificate in Vaccine Hesitancy & Minority Communities course is a timely and essential program designed to address the critical issue of vaccine hesitancy in minority communities. This course is crucial in today's world, where the COVID-19 pandemic has highlighted the urgent need to ensure equitable access to vaccines and combat misinformation.

Course Details
• Understanding Vaccine Hesitancy in Minority Communities
• Historical Context: Medical Experimentation and Minority Groups
• Culturally Competent Communication in Vaccine Education
• Addressing Misinformation and Fostering Trust in Vaccines
• Community Engagement Strategies for Vaccine Outreach
• Overcoming Barriers to Vaccination in Underserved Populations
• Vaccine Policy and Equity in Minority Communities
• Case Studies: Successful Vaccine Hesitancy Interventions
• Ethical Considerations in Vaccine Hesitancy Research and Practice
• Monitoring and Evaluating Vaccine Hesitancy Initiatives in Minority Communities
